Get started74 Bradford Road is a four-bedroom detached house in Atworth, Melksham, Melksham (SN12 8HY). It has a recorded floor area of 170 m² (around 1830 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band C. Other recorded features include notable views. The latest certificate (September 2020)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 9.1%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£823,000 is 12.7%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£399/sq ft) was about 40.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 170 m² the property is well over the postcode median (95 m² across 20 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. On energy efficiency it sits in the top 10% of properties in this postcode. 3 planning records sit against the property, 3 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ension, partial demolition and a porch,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Last sale on file: £730,000 in July 2021.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
